Zelensky changed the staff of the Supreme Commander-in-Chief

The President of Ukraine, Volodymyr Zelenskyi, introduced General Oleksandr Pavlyuk, previously appointed First Deputy Minister of Defense, to the Headquarters of the Supreme Commander-in-Chief.

The relevant decree made public on the president’s website.

“To introduce to the staff of the Supreme Commander-in-Chief Pavlyuk Oleksandr Oleksiyovych – the First Deputy Minister of Defense of Ukraine,” the decree reads.
